Determine the sum of the parts 1 3/8 +2/3=

2 1/24

Rewriting our equation with parts separated

2/3+1+3/8

Solving the fraction parts

2/3+3/8=?

Find the LCD of 2/3 and 3/8 and rewrite to solve with the equivalent fractions.

LCD = 24

16/24+9/24=25/24

Simplifying the fraction part, 25/24,

25/24=1 1/24

Combining the whole and fraction parts

1+1+1/24=2 1/24
